Gsm ussd broken modem command software

Ussd can be used for wap browsing, prepaid callback service, mobilemoney services, locationbased content services, menubased information services, and as part of. These commands come from hayes at commands that were used by the hayes smart modems in 1980s. Most commands have a default value, which is the value that is set at the factory. It supports the can bus protocol, includes a gsm modem for tracking purposes, a set of relays for general purpose, a low quiescent current voltage regulator for low current drain of mcu when battery powered, and a switched mode power supply smps for modem. I heard that minicom can do it, apparently it can execute ussd commands.

Can someone tell me the correct way to use this command. Most modem have a guard time of 1 second in which no additional data should be sent to the modem before or after the escape code is sent, or it will be ignored. What is gsm global system for mobile communication. How to use microsoft hyperterminal to send at commands to a.

These are some apps with ussd balance check support. The at command in the second atinout command is just to get the unsolicited ussd answer displayed as a side effect, which should have arrived after the sleep. Tried to connect the modem to the gprs but ended up with fail. The sms specification has defined a way for a computer to send sms messages through a mobile phone or gsmgprs modem. Running ussd command on gsm modem wrong encoding maybe. Request the given modem to initiate a ussd session with command. On a system reinstalling encounter with problem didnt work 3g modems connect manager. Software must work with huawei gsm modem model e1552 and e1550 3. I have seen that most gsm modules modems hang up, if you send at commands to fast. This will install gsm ussd and its documentation in usrlocal. Sending sms messages from a computer using a mobile phone or gsmgprs modem.

Unstructured supplementary service data ussd is service offered by network providers to get information about subscriber account, mobilemoney services, menubased information services etc. Many modems today including dialup, wireless, gsmgprs modems use these at command set for communication. This option causes gsmussd to send ussd queries in cleartext, i. Modemmanager is a dbuspowered linux daemon which provides a unified high level. You can do this from the send message page of the gsm modem gateway in the console program or with a message from one of the connectors.

Connecting your gsm modem with a serial cable is a very secure way to use a gsm modem. Here are some of the tasks that can be done using at commands with a gsmgprs modem or mobile phone. It is a list of at commands that are sent when a connection to the modem is being established. Ussd can be used for wap browsing, prepaid callback service, mobilemoney services, locationbased content services, menubased. The sms specification has defined a way for a computer to send sms messages through a mobile phone or gsm gprs modem. It seems that reading char by char is safer is this case. How to program to check prepaid balance on a gsm modem. This code is used for gsmlte, cdma, iden, tetra and umts public land mobile.

It can be found at start programs accessories communications. Sending ussd commands using web script to gsm sim card. Switches the modem from data to command state, which usually disconnects modem this command is not proceeded by at. I had been studied a problem socalled lags of modems in practice it has appeared that modems do not hang and lose a network and at usual reboot the modem registers again sim a card in a network.

Any phone that supports the extended at command set for sendingreceiving sms messages, as defined in etsi gsm 07. Network registration sms ussd sim sim phonebook control gpio. When i use putty and our program to run the ussd command for such a. Software must support multiple modem in 1 pc and can rename the modem name 4. At commands are software interface for wireless modules. Ussd can be used for wap browsing, prepaid callback service, mobilemoney services, locationbased content. This option causes gsm ussd to send ussd queries in cleartext, i. You can able to check your balance, remaining data or recharge your account right from your gp internet modem without open internet sim from modem. Please note, that it will not hang if you wait for ok all the time. Secondly as ussd command responses will be returned as an unsolicited response and therefore will not be stored alongside your smss. The drivers should be available from the manufacturer. Gsm repair guide software free download gsm repair guide. Executing ussd via at command from huawei modem does not. Unstructured supplementary service data ussd is a protocol used by gsm cellular telephones to communicate with the service providers computers.

However, some books and web sites use them interchangeably as the name of an at command. My laptop has an integrated gsm hspda modem that i can use to connect to the internet with a sim card. This takes precedence before any detected modem type. Gsm modem software free download gsm modem top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. On which modem the network loses the reasons for me are not clear since at loss of a network he is obliged in an automatic mode to be reregistered, but. Sending sms messages from a computer using a mobile phone or gsm gprs modem. Gsm modem software free download gsm modem top 4 download. The expect programs differ in the way they react to modem answers. Most modem have a guard time of 1 second in which no additional data should be sent to the modem before or. Sending ussd using diafaan sms server support forum. Ussd for gp modem gp internet modem user face some problem while they wants to check balance or remaining data or recharge your account right from gp modem via ussd but here is the solution. Gsm global system for mobile communication is a digital mobile network that is widely used by mobile phone users in europe and other parts of the world. I could do a work around, and broke the ussd command into a two. Gsm modems are optimized for sms and data transmission and often support advanced options like automatic resets and onboard software.

Arducc is an avrbased platform that is optimized for automotive and industrial systems. All other commands are working well for me except for ussd commands which are appearing to be returning a hexadecimal or encrypted string in the response. A gsm gprs modem is a wireless modem that works with gsm gprs wireless networks. Install the most recent version of the modems drivers, which will ensure the host system is able to connect properly to the modem. The ussd string is specified as the recipient phone number to. To know rest traffic or account balance have to switching off modem, push sim card into cell phone and by means of ussd commands to require balance and rest of traffic. No extra drivers are necessary and the cable can be fixed tightly to the server and the gsm modem. Ussd queries can tell you your current prepaid account balance, the phone number of the sim card in your modem, and a lot more, depending on your gsm net provider. We have written an npm module for encoding and decoding of gsm 7bit. Possible values, 0 single mode 1 alternating voicefax teleservice 61 2 alternating voicedata bearer service 61 3 voice followed by data bearer. So i downloaded it but i dont have a clue where to.

A gsmgprs modem is a wireless modem that works with gsmgprs wireless networks. Send sms ussd with a gsm modem discus and support send sms ussd with a gsm modem in windows 10 support to solve the problem. If you do not wait, then you will load more charaters in the buffer of the gsm modem, then it can store. Im trying to check the sim card balance via ussd using huawei e1550 3g modem. Please someone explain to me why the gsm modem keep showing error while i execute those gprs command above. You must press enter depending on the terminal program it could be some other key to send the command to the modem. Prepaid manager is an applet for the gnome desktop that allows you to check and top up the balance of gsm mobile prepaid sim cards. Brilliant, so now i can send the text bro bal to 2200 and get a text back with the balance. Eventually i pinned it down to devttyusb10 and could get a balance out of it, so i can confirm that gsm ussd will work on the cellc huawei e1752. Gsm uses a variation of time division multiple access and is the most widely used of the three digital wireless telephony technologies. You can use the linux command line tool gsm ussd to send ussd codes, get answers, and even navigate ussd menus. This compact 3g2g modem connects directly to device managers host system by a usb 2. Ive been already followed the gprs command that been shown as above. Modem manager gui modem manager gui is a simple gtk based graphical interface compatible with modem manager, wader and.

This mode is used if the gsm modem cannot notify the computer when a new text message is received. Secondly as ussd command responses will be returned as an unsolicited response. Unstructured supplementary service data ussd, sometimes referred to as quick codes or feature codes, is a communications protocol used by gsm cellular telephones to communicate with the mobile network operator s computers. Eventually i pinned it down to devttyusb10 and could get a balance out of it, so i can confirm that gsmussd will work on the cellc huawei e1752. Mtn prepaid, huawei e220 3g modem on ubuntukubuntu linux i heard that minicom can do it, apparently it can execute ussd commands. If the ussd command returns a response, this response will be directed to 2way sms. How to check bundle balance with ussd gsmussd mybroadband.

Ussd for gp modem life with internet, we are the internet. Basic at commands for sim900a gsmgprs module pantech blog. Any time the modem receives a command, it sends a response known as a result. You can use it to send at commands to your mobile phone or gsmgprs modem. How to program to check prepaid balance on a gsm modem using. A gsm modem could also be a standard gsm mobile phone with the appropriate cable and software driver to connect to a serial port or usb port on your computer. If you dont have modemmanager already installed, this next command will probably install it along with the gui. I am using gsmussd to try and query my data balance from my 3g modem. This will install gsmussd and its documentation in usrlocal. This code is used for gsmlte, cdma, iden, tetra and umts public land.

For the case that querying your balance requires operating a ussd menu. The ok is basically telling you the ussd command syntax was valid and a ussd command was sent from your mobile device to the operator network, nothing more. I am trying to execute ussd codes through my gsm modem. You can send a ussd command by sending an empty message with the ussd code as the destination number and with message type sd. When i try ussd command which gives me some option, it is executed but i cant get any operation done from the options. Must work with windows server 2003, windows xp and windows 7 64 bit 5.

1550 1262 1195 34 486 1092 864 290 713 481 544 1254 137 1019 187 44 1529 301 263 1637 786 1499 1479 1422 239 653 1225 1214 265 231 1063 156 831 450 1075 1028 719 200 255 858 581 250 165 816